Intel encourages employees to get involved in community service, and roughly half volunteer their time to projects and causes they’re passionate about—from local sustainability projects to far-reaching educational programs.

Intel works to better the lives of people the world over. Through our philanthropic Intel Foundation, we develop and fund a range of programs that advance education, diversity, and quality of life worldwide.
